WebYou can invest in shares of a company seeking a listing on the Singapore Exchange (SGX) through its initial public offering (IPO). You can also invest in shares of companies that are already listed on the SGX through a broker. On the SGX, shares are mostly traded in board lots of 100. If a share is priced at $1, you pay $100 to invest in one ...
